Sudanese security forces arrested two suspects in the murder of a U.S. diplomat Saturday, the official state news agency announced. John Granville, an official for the U.S. Agency for International Development, was being driven home late at night on Jan. 1 when another vehicle cut off his car and opened fire, killing both the diplomat and his driver, before fleeing the scene.
